    Hello all,
    I have a nooby question as I'm wading into the world of AATVs. I'm looking at what is described to me as a 1988 Argo. Its an 8x8 machine and the seller has indicated to me that the model is a V8823. I thought Argo models were named (Conquest, Magnum etc). Is V8823 the actual model name? Serial number provided to me is NKB85523 if anyone can cross reference that anywhere.
    Any comments/insights are welcome and thanks in advance.
    MD

  • #2
    I have a 1987 I/C 8x8 NKB80067. back then they were called I/C 8x8. if you goto beaverdamargo.com u can download pdf manuals witch have the model names and serial numbers for the different years.
